F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

1,165 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Ford (F)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$24.3B — down 1.8% from $24.7B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 79 funds closed out of F and 76 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 465 trimmed existing stakes and 421 added.

The largest buyer was Greenhaven Associates, adding an estimated $207M. The largest seller was Franklin Resources, cutting an estimated $352M.
